Abstract

Abstract In this part of the paper, we will study the behavior of PUR polyurethane at different mechanical and thermal stresses, stresses for which this material behaves very well. It is known that this material behaves well as a protective material against shocks, so it is used as protection against mechanical elements. PUR behaves excellently at uneven static stresses and dynamic stresses. That is why it is used in the construction of the rollers of medium weight mobile devices or rollers that have cam functionality, strongly required for static and dynamic contact. PUR has very good thermal properties, it is used as a thermal insulator when it is in the form of high-density polyurethane foam (PUR / PIR).
